Lakeland (Florida) has no state income tax, boosting take-home vs Thessaloniki (GR rate: 22%).

Frequently asked questions

Is $100K a good salary in Lakeland?

At $100K/year in Lakeland, your estimated monthly take-home is $6,321. With 1BR rent around $1,450/month, rent takes up 23% of your take-home. That's considered comfortable.

Is $100K a good salary in Thessaloniki?

At $100K/year in Thessaloniki, your estimated monthly take-home is $4,488. With 1BR rent around $590/month, rent takes up 13% of your take-home. That's considered very comfortable.

Which city is more affordable on a $100K salary?

Lakeland le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$4,208/month vs $3,248/month in Thessaloniki.

Can I afford to live alone in Lakeland on $100K?

Yes. At $100K in Lakeland, rent takes 23% of your take-home, leaving $4,208/month after essentials. Most financial planners recommend keeping rent below 30%.
